I run a very stable Centos Server currently 5.2 have been using VBox since it came out. Apart form the sometimes flaky HIF networking on reboots. (Have to do service netork restart on the guest to get it working.
VBox is great. However.
Read about the latest and greatest and the promise of much simpler HIF networking.
See link to centos thread. No joy as yet from there.
http://www.centos.org/modules/newbb/vie ... mpost66296
I upgraded after backing up my VM's -FORTUNATELY
I culd run the new 2.1 GUI but trying to start any of my VM's resulted ina complete hang on the host server that only a hard rebooot would solve.
Disabling networkingon the client configs allowed me to boot htem, but whatever networking choice I made resulted in a Host system hang on startup.
I manage dto regress to my stable 2.04 and then I have since upgraded to 2.06 with zero issues. 4 VM's running fine. Can anyone post a step by step to upgrade to 2.1. Or should I wait for 2.1.x
